Fees

To complete a grade, you need a minimum of 6 credits – 4 from core courses and 2 from electives. The overall price depends on the number of subjects selected, as not all courses provide the same amount of credit. 

The cost of 6 credits is US$3,500/year. You add more courses or choose technology courses at an additional cost.

Check our Course Catalog  to gain a clear idea of our course panel. Our admission team will offer guidance and advice to create the best solutions for your requirements during the enrollment process.

An initial deposit of $100 is needed to confirm enrollment. The remaining fee can be paid in 2 installments – one before the start of the course and the other 4 months after.  A discounted rate applies if the whole fee is paid before the start of the course. 

Simply let our admission team know what is your preferred plan.

TPT International offers the option to opt for a Standard or Honors diploma.

A standard diploma is carefully designed for students pursuing eligibility for the NCAA to progress their athletic careers alongside their education. It’s also ideal for those who want to enter the workforce or community and technical colleges.

An Honors diploma is perfect for students who wish to enter a four-year College or University. We highly recommend that each student researches the admission requirements of their preferred institution(s) to maximize their admission chances.

Technology courses are project-based courses in animation and design. They count towards your diploma and teach you how to go beyond being a technology user and become a creator. They have a different price compared to our standard courses.

To be considered a full-time student 24 credits are required:

English: 4 Credits
Science: 3 Credits
Social Studies: 3 Credits
Math: 4 Credits

Fine & Performing Arts, Speech & Debate or Practical Arts: 1 Credit
Physical Education: 1 Credit
Electives: 6 Credits
Foreign Language: 2 Credits

Each course is divided into units. Tests ensure the correct assimilation of skills and information, while optional activities enhance your knowledge and provide additional points.

Once all units have been completed, you will take a final exam that requires a minimum score of 70% to be passed.

The final exam score plus any optional activity points determine the course grade.
